H.R. No. 443
 
 
 
R E S O L U T I O N
 
         WHEREAS, Many proud Texans are gathering in Austin on
  February 21, 2017, to celebrate Texas A&M University--Corpus
  Christi Day at the State Capitol; and
         WHEREAS, The school traces its beginnings to 1947, when the
  University of Corpus Christi was established; the institution
  became a part of The Texas A&M University System in 1989; and
         WHEREAS, Today, the university serves more than 12,000
  students; it offers bachelor's, master's, and doctoral degrees in
  the Colleges of Business, Education and Human Development, Liberal
  Arts, Nursing and Health Sciences, and Science and Engineering; and
         WHEREAS, Home to world-class centers and institutes
  conducting autonomous research focused on the Gulf of Mexico, the
  university continues to bring new programs and initiatives to the
  campus, including a bachelor's degree in electrical engineering, a
  Ph.D. in geospatial computing science, and a doctorate in nursing
  practice; and
         WHEREAS, Texas A&M University--Corpus Christi is one of the
  foremost institutions of higher education in the state, and it is
  truly fitting that a day be set aside to recognize its many
  contributions to the growth and prosperity of the Lone Star State;
  now, therefore, be it
         R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 85th Texas
  Legislature hereby recognize February 21, 2017, as Texas A&M
  University--Corpus Christi Day at the State Capitol and commend the
  university's administration, faculty, and staff on their
  commitment to fostering excellence in education; and, be it further
         R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be
  prepared for the university as an expression of high regard by the
  Texas House of Representatives.
